This month we have an article about a Truck Conversion written by Kevin Daniels.  They call these Totorhome's which is short for towing motor home because they are generally heavy duty rigs that are self-contained motorhomes, but they are also designed to tow heavy duty trailers.  These are generally for boys with big toys and they provide some advantages over a bus conversion as they generally have more ground clearance and can get off the beaten path a bit more than a 40 – 45' bus.   Bottom line, these Totorhome's have all of the same appliances and amenities as bus conversions do, so they fit in the same category as what you have been reading about for the past 24 years.

This particular Totorhome also tows a small towable conversion built much like a small house.  These are referred as Tiny Houses.  Many Tiny Houses are stationary, but many are also built on trailers and are moveable.  They are generally not made to travel millions of miles like a bus or truck can do, but to move occasionally from one spot to another, to live in part time or full time.  Just like the Totorhome's, Tiny Houses on wheels generally have the same appliances and amenities that trucks and bus conversions do.
